Shasta County Public Health Reports New Measles Case

Another case of Measles has been reported by Shasta County Public Health. If you have not been vaccinated and were in any of the following places at the listed dates & times, you should watch for symptoms and limit contact with others, especially infants and pregnant women, for 21 days. the locations are:

-Hinkles Market on April 3rd
-Club 501 on April 5th and 6th from 10PM to 2AM
-Shasta Regional Medical Center on April 4th from 9AM to 1PM and the 7th from 1:45 to 5:15PM and 9:15PM to 12:30AM
-Shasta Community Health Center on April 8th from 12:30 to 3PM
-Uber customers may have been exposed on April 4th from 8:30 to 10:30AM and 11:30AM to 1:30PM. Also on April 5th between 1PM and 2:30PM. There were also exposures reported on the 7th and 8th at various times.
-Lyft passengers and drivers may have been exposed on April 4th from 8:30AM to 10:30AM, and from 11:30AM to 3PM. Other exposure times include on the 5th from 1PM to 2:30PM, on the 7th various times, and on the 8th from 1:15PM to 2:30PM.
-The Walgreens on Eureka Way on April 4th from Noon until 2PM.

Measles is highly a contagious viral disease spread through the air. People who’ve had 2 doses of vaccine have less than 1% chance of getting the disease. Nationwide, almost 500 cases have been reported in 19 states.
